The Alabama 4-H Youth Development Center, located on 264 idyllic acres along the shores of Lay Lake in central Alabama, plays an important role in the development of Alabama’s youth and adults.

The Center is a combination of camp, forest, conference center, education and training facility, nature preserve, bird sanctuary and game refuge. It is an area where all living things are important, where all are a part of the 4-H Center environment. Annually, approximately 17,000 youth and adults attend 4-H environmental stewardship camps and educational training.

To continue and expand the mission of the Alabama 4-H Youth Development Center as well as all of Alabama 4-H, plans are underway to construct and fully equip a new environmental education facility and 17 guest rooms and suites at the 4-H Center. This new facility will help Alabama youth and the state’s educators by providing them with cutting-edge environmental education based on sound science, as well as leadership educational opportunities they can use now and in the future.
